American Platinum Eagle $50 Half-Ounce Coin
A Scarce Fractional Platinum Treasure from the United States Mint
Discover one of the most collectible and elusive precious metal coins ever produced by the U.S. Mint: the $50 American Platinum Eagle Half-Ounce. Struck in 1/2 troy ounce of .9995 fine platinum, this exceptional coin offers all the prestige and beauty of the renowned American Platinum Eagle series in a more accessible fractional format. Introduced in 1997, the half-ounce denomination combines stunning artistry, government-backed purity, and remarkably low mintages that have made many dates highly sought after by collectors.
Featuring John Mercanti's iconic Statue of Liberty design on the obverse and the classic soaring eagle reverse on bullion issues, the $50 Platinum Eagle represents American strength, freedom, and excellence in precious metal coinage. The denomination was produced only from 1997 through 2008, making the series a finite and increasingly collectible chapter in modern U.S. numismatics.
Specifications
- Face Value: $50 USD
- Weight: 1/2 Troy Ounce Platinum
- Purity: .9995 Fine Platinum
- Issuer: United States Mint
- Legal Tender Status: Backed by the United States Government
- Production Period: 1997-2008 only
Collector Appeal
The half-ounce Platinum Eagle is one of the hidden gems of modern U.S. bullion coinage. Unlike Gold and Silver Eagles, Platinum Eagle fractional denominations were discontinued after 2008, permanently limiting the number of available examples. Several dates boast mintages under 10,000 coins, with the 2007 issue totaling just 7,001 pieces, making it one of the key dates of the series.
These low production figures, combined with the coin's limited 12-year run and intrinsic platinum value, have made the $50 Platinum Eagle increasingly attractive to both investors and advanced collectors. Many enthusiasts view the series as one of the most underrated modern U.S. Mint programs due to its combination of precious metal content, rarity, and historic significance.

Half-Ounce $50 American Platinum Eagle Bullion Mintages
| Year | Mintage |
|---|---|
| 1997 | 20,500 |
| 1998 | 32,419 |
| 1999 | 32,309 |
| 2000 | 18,892 |
| 2001 | 12,815 |
| 2002 | 24,005 |
| 2003 | 17,409 |
| 2004 | 13,236 |
| 2005 | 9,013 |
| 2006 | 9,602 |
| 2007 | 7,001 |
| 2008 | 14,000 |
